rendelharris Posted November 20, 2018 Share Posted November 20, 2018 The Market Porter in Borough Market has a lovely dining room upstairs with reasonably priced quality food, much of it sourced from the market itself.If you happen to have any kids amongst your guests they will be mighty impressed by the fact that the pub featured in a Harry Potter film! WomblingFree Posted November 21, 2018 Share Posted November 21, 2018 I go to Mango off Borough Market quite a lot - great if you're in the mood for a (slightly) fancy Indian. A bit pricy but the food's quite rich so you don't necessarily need starters and side dishes. www.lovemango.co.ukAlso agree with Captain Marvel and JoeLeg on Champor Champor, great restaurant.
